Description

Boling Road is both agricultural and residential. The Litter bugs consistently throw litter from their vehicles while driving (usually very fast for the road). There is a creek on this road, and a lot of trash washes down the ditches towards the creek. There is ample wildlife and domestic animals exposed to the trash. Items such as dirty baby diapers have been found numerous times. Beer bottles thrown from the cars pose a risk to drivers when they are broken on the pavement. The entire road is affected by the litter. I clean the ditch in front of my home at least once per week. It is filled with trash consistently.
